You Grow You Know

 

You grow you know
when the greys in your hair
dont need to hide
when you can safely abide
In old loves lost
In graceful moments past
And you savour the faint aromas
They left behind;
And they grow sweeter each day.

You grow you know
That the gentle face of tomorrow
Is a figment of your imagination
As wispy as your yesterdays
As fragile as your nows.
And you gather their seeds
You kept in a gossamer bag
Behind the last shelf of your mind
And you scatter them
In the garden of your children.

You grow you know
When you last cried
It was only a child that never knew.
And all the while,your soul stood smiling
Behind you

You grow you know
when Life and Truth, Piety and
Honesty and all those people-binding words
Mean nothing in the face of Love.
For all humans are creatures of circumstance
And you and they
Really are
More than just people.
You grow you know.
